Cloud & API Economy
The API economy is the exposure of an organization’s digital services andassets through application programming interfaces (API) in a controlled way.APIs ensure that the data extracted from one software application isformatted and passed to the next application without change. By exposingthe interfaces that allow microservices to communicate with each other,vendors are able to meet the needs of specific groups of customers withouthaving to redesign the organization's software
IoT
The “Internet of Everything” is the next big and imminent thing as businessesstart to collect data from device ranging from mobile phones to customdevices. The independent communication between different connecteddevices can be used to optimize operations, reduce costs, boost productivityand more importantly, promote financial inclusion among developing countries.Within a few years, the usage of devices increased from millions to billions andthe amount of time spent on these devices has been steadily rising.
